万博体育3.0手机版只要在本发明的实质精神范围之内

当前位置:万博体育3.0手机版 > 万博体育3.0手机版 > 万博体育3.0手机版只要在本发明的实质精神范围之内
作者: 万博体育3.0手机版|来源: http://www.protq.com|栏目:万博体育3.0手机版

文章关键词:万博体育3.0手机版,程序转换

  【专利摘要】本发明提供一种程序转换系统。该系统应用于比对仪上。该比对仪设有处理单元和存储单元。该程序转换系统包括运行于该处理单元上的多个模块。该多个模块包括:程序导入模块,用于导入一程序数据包,该程序数据包包括第一量测程序中和至少一样品的量测参数;程序转换模块,用于将该第一量测程序转换为适用于该比对仪的第二量测程序;特征参数抓取模块,用于从该程序数据包中抓取该至少一样品的量测参数;及存储模块,用于将该第二量测程序和量测参数存储于该存储单元中。本发明还提供一种程序转换方法。通过将适用于一设备的第一量测程序和量测参数转换为适用于比对仪的第二量测程序和量测参数,缩减了程序编写过程,出错率降低。

  [0002] DMIS 值imensional Measurement Interface Specification)是自动化系统之间 检测数据的通信标准,所用的程序语言是PC-DMIS。比对仪是一种接触式扫描设备,其使用 时需要样品的实际特征参数作为参考。当比对仪用于配合DMIS使用时,需先在DMIS中编 写量测程序,量测一遍样品,取得量测特征参数,然后在比对仪上按量测特征的参数顺序再 次编写量测程序。由于需在不同的设备上进行二次编程,出错率高,编程效率低。

  [0003] 有鉴于此,有必要提供一种程序转换系统和程序转换方法,能够降低出错率,提高 编程效率,W解决上述问题。

  [0004] 本发明提供一种程序转换系统,其应用于比对仪上,该比对仪设有处理单元和存 储单元。该程序转换系统包括运行于该处理单元上的多个模块,该多个模块包括:程序导入 模块,用于导入一程序数据包,该程序数据包包括第一量测程序和至少一样品的量测参数; 程序转换模块,用于将该第一量测程序转换为适用于该比对仪的第二量测程序;特征参数 抓取模块,用于从该程序数据包中抓取该至少一样品的量测参数;及存储模块,用于将该第 二量测程序和该至少一样品的量测参数存储于该存储单元中。 阳〇化]本发明提供一种程序转换方法,其应用于比对仪上。该程序转换方法包括步骤:导 入一程序数据包,万博体育3.0手机版该程序数据包包括第一量测程序和至少一样品的量测参数;将该第一量 测程序转换为适用于比对仪的第二量测程序及从该程序数据包中抓取该至少一样品的量 测参数;及将该第二量测程序和该至少一样品的量测参数存储。

  [0006] 通过将适用于一设备的第一量测程序转换为适用于比对仪的第二量测程序,且将 通过该设备量测的至少一样品的量测参数转换为适用于该比对仪的量测参数,使得该比对 仪能够直接使用该设备的程序和数据,从而缩减了程序编写过程,节省成本,工作效率高, 且出错率降低。

  [0011] 请一并参考图1和图2,图1为本发明一实施方式中一种程序转换系统100应用 于如图2所示的比对仪200上的模块示意图。该比对仪200设有处理单元210和存储单元 220。该程序转换系统100包括运行于该处理单元210上的多个模块。该多个模块包括程 序导入模块110、程序转换模块120、特征参数抓取模块130、程序纠错模块140和存储模块 150。

  [0012] 该程序导入模块110用于导入一程序数据包,该程序数据包包括第一量测程序和 至少一样品的量测参数。在本实施方式中,第一量测程序的程序语言为PC-DMIS。

  [0013] 该程序转换模块120用于将该第一量测程序转换为适用于比对仪200的第二量测 程序。在本实施方式中,该第二量测程序的格式为DMI文件。

  [0014] 该特征参数抓取模块130用于从该程序数据包中抓取该至少一样品的量测参数。 在本实施方式中,该至少一样品的量测参数还被转换为CAL格式文件。

  [0015] 该程序纠错模块140用于对第一量测程序和第二量测程序进行比对,W对不一致 的地方进行纠错。

  [0016] 该存储模块150用于将第二量测程序和至少一样品的量测参数存储于存储单元 220中。本实施方式中,该存储模块150用于将格式为DMI的第二量测程序和格式为CAL的 量测参数存储于存储单元220中。

  [0017] 请一并参考图3,为一种程序转换方法的流程图。该程序转换方法包括如下步骤: 步骤S310 :导入一程序数据包,该程序数据包包括第一量测程序和至少一样品的量测 参数。具体地,程序导入模块110导入一程序数据包,该程序数据包包括第一量测程序和至 少一样品的量测参数。其中,第一量测程序的程序语言为PC-DMIS。

  [0018] 步骤S320 :将该第一量测程序转换为适用于比对仪的第二量测程序,且从该程序 数据包中抓取该至少一样品的量测参数。具体地,程序转换模块120将该第一量测程序转 换为适用于比对仪200的第二量测程序,该第二量测程序为DMI文件;并且,该特征参数 抓取模块130还从该程序数据包中抓取该至少一样品的量测参数,并将该量测参数转换为 CAL格式文件。

  [0019] 步骤S330 :对第一量测程序和第二量测程序进行比对,并对不一致的地方进行纠 错。具体地,程序纠错模块140对第一量测程序和第二量测程序进行比对,并对不一致的地 方进行纠错。

  [0020] 步骤S340:将第二量测程序和该至少一样品的量测参数存储。具体地,存储模块 150用于将该格式为DMI的第二量测程序W及格式为CAL的至少一样品的量侧参数存储于 存储单元220中。

  [0021] 通过将适用于一设备的第一量测程序转换为适用于比对仪的第二量测程序,且将 通过该设备量测的至少一样品的量测参数转换为适用于该比对仪的量测参数,使得该比对 仪能够直接使用该设备的程序和数据,从而缩减了程序编写过程,节省成本,工作效率高, 且出错率降低。

  [0022] 可理解,如果能够保证第一量测程序正确转换为第二量测程序,则程序纠错模块 140可省略。

  [0023] 本技术领域的普通技术人员应当认识到,W上的实施方式仅是用来说明本发明, 而并非用作为对本发明的限定,只要在本发明的实质精神范围之内,对W上实施方式所作 的适当改变和变化都落在本发明要求保护的范围之内。

  1. 一种程序转换系统,应用于一比对仪上,该比对仪上设有一处理单元和一存储单元; 其特征在于:该程序转换系统包括运行于该处理单元上的多个模组,该多个模组包括: 程序导入模块,用于导入一程序数据包,该程序数据包包括第一量测程序和至少一样 品的量测参数; 程序转换模块,用于将该第一量测程序转换为适用于比对仪的第二量测程序; 特征参数抓取模块,用于从该程序数据包中抓取该至少一样品的量测参数;及 存储模块,用于将该第二量测程序和该至少一样品的量测参数存储于该存储单元中。2. 如权利要求1所述的程序转换系统,其特征在于:该第一量测程序的程序语言是 PC-DMIS。3. 如权利要求1所述的程序转换系统,其特征在于:该第二量测程序为DMI文件。4. 如权利要求1所述的程序转换系统,其特征在于:该特征参数抓取模块还将该至少 一样品的量测参数转换为CAL文件。5. 如权利要求1所述的程序转换系统,其特征在于:该多个模组还包括: 程序纠错模块,用于对该第一量测程序和第二量测程序进行比对以对不一致的地方进 行纠错。6. -种程序转换方法,应用于一比对仪上;其特征在于:该程序转换方法包括步骤: 导入一程序数据包,该程序数据包包括第一量测程序和至少一样品的量测参数; 将该第一量测程序转换为适用于比对仪的第二量测程序,及于从该程序数据包中抓取 该至少一样品的量测参数;及 将该第二量测程序和该至少一样品的量测参数存储。7. 如权利要求6所述的程序转换方法,其特征在于:该第一量测程序的程序语言是 PC-DMIS。8. 如权利要求6所述的程序转换方法,其特征在于:该第二量测程序为DMI文件。9. 如权利要求6所述的程序转换方法,其特征在于:该特征参数抓取模块还将该至少 一样品的量测参数转换为CAL文件。10. 如权利要求6所述的程序转换方法,其特征在于:该程序转换方法还包括步骤: 对该第一量测程序和第二量测程序进行比对,并对不一致的地方进行纠错。

网友评论

我的2016年度评论盘点
还没有评论,快来抢沙发吧!